I'm stuck using a Vaio Flip 15A (4500u/HD 4400, GT 735M, 8GB, SSD) to power the laptop's active digitizer and two external displays (full HD).

I see videos stutter (including when the 735M is disabled) about a quarter of the time in general on any of the displays and other times I'll experience lag in Photoshop (~full HD canvas, 1-3 layers only) about half of the time when Google Hangouts is also on.

Am I asking too much of the system? Would a laptop cooler solve these problems or could it be the software?
